    Frogs are protected under the European Union Habitats Directive and by the Irish Wildlife Act.

    The Common Frog (Rana temporaria) is the only species of frog found in Ireland and is listed as an internationally important species.

    Gone are the days of the live frog swallowing competitions in Ballycumber, Co. Offaly.
